Wes ends Palace glove affair

Crystal Palace keeper Wes Foderingham has completed a full time switch to Swindon.

The former England U19 star joins the League Two club for an undisclosed fee after a successful loan spell, penning a two-and-a-half year deal.

Foderingham, 20, has kept nine clean sheets and conceded just six goals in 15 games for the Robins after originally brought in as cover for the injured Phil Smith but has since claimed the no.1 jersey.

He tweeted: "massive thank you to @Official_CPFC and every1 at the club! i wish the club all the best and will follow the cpfc throughout my career"

The stopper joined Palace in August 2010 from Bromley shortly after being released by Fulham but never played for the Eagles.

He returned to Bromley on loan before making nine appearances at the end of last season with non-league outfit Histon but it was at Swindon where he really impressed after joining on loan in October 2011.

Meanwhile, Andy Dorman's loan at Bristol Rovers has now been extended for an extra month.
